The derails at the junction were originally RR points weren't they
which literally put the car on the ground and they were operated by the
tower, not the approaching trolley. This derail could only catch runaway
cars possibly unattended when a relief is made; this derail would not
catch a vehicle with slack brakes. Look very closely in this photo
http://www.davesrailpix.com/pitts/htm/pitt605..htm and you can see the
derail among the weeds.
